## Log Compaction — Brindlequeue

Compaction on Brindlequeue runs nightly at 02:10 and prunes tombstoned segments older than 72 hours. Before forcing a manual compaction, confirm the consumer lag on the `ledger-events` topic is under 500 messages, or you risk dropping unread records. Manual runs go through the Opsgate admin endpoint, which authenticates against our internal key service. Use the key below when invoking it.

service key, fawip-bajef: kto11_Qt5wZK9vdNC

Subject: Formula sandbox handover

Hey Dorit,

Quick brain-dump before I'm out. The Calcwren sandbox evaluates user-supplied formulas in a locked-down worker — no file access, 2s CPU cap. Occasionally a formula slips past the parser and wedges a worker; just restart the pool, it's safe. The denylist lives in the sandbox_rules table, so add patterns there if you spot a new abuse vector. For edits, the rules database is reachable via the connection string below.

replica DSN, yahog-kawig: redis://istox_svc:um@db-8a67.halixforge.test:5432/frawyn

# Provenance: Quillmark doc linter

Quillmark builds run on the Fernhollow runner pool only. Each release is built twice; digests must match before publish. On-call: if a customer-facing lint rule misfires, check that the deployed digest matches the provenance record before blaming rule logic. Mismatches mean a stale rollout, not a regression. Escalate stale rollouts to the platform rotation. The currently verified release corresponds to the token recorded below.

pipeline stamp: htk31_f769b577b3028a4e9958e5bb8d1259a

## Changelog — Quillcheck 3.2.0

Renamed setting: LINTER_AUTH_TOKEN is now DOCLINT_API_CREDENTIAL to match the Fernwald naming convention. The old name is no longer read as of this release; CI jobs referencing it will fail closed rather than silently skip linting. For the security review, note that the renamed credential is set on the line immediately below.

secret setting of baduf-fahag: LEDGER_TOKEN8=35e35511